Razer's New Kishi V3 Controllers Can Fit up to a 13-Inch iPad
- Razer's new Kishi V3 controllers can fit up to a 13-inch iPad.
- The Kishi V3 Pro XL is designed for gaming on larger mobile devices and supports both iPads and Android tablets.
- It is priced at $200, making it one of the most expensive mobile controllers available.
- The Kishi V3 Pro XL includes a 6-month pass to Apple Arcade, while smaller versions offer a 3-month pass.

Razer Kishi V3 Lineup With Support for 13-Inch Tablets Launched: See Price
Razer Kishi V3 series of mobile gaming controllers was launched on Thursday, and the new Razer Kishi V3, Kishi V3 Pro, and Kishi V3 Pro XL are compatible with iOS, Android devices and PCs. The Kishi V3 Pro XL can support larger devices, including 13-inch iPads and Android tablets, if they feature a USB Type-C port.
